Miscellaneous. LEA AND PERRINS’ CELEBRATED WORCESTERSHIRE SAUCE, declared by Connoisseurs to be THE ONLY GOOD SAUCE. CAUTION AGAINST FRAUD. The success of this most delicious and unrivalled condiment having caused certain dealers to applv the name of “ Worcestershire Sauce” to’their own inferior compounds, the public is hereby informed that the only way to secure the genuine, is to ask for Lea and Perrins’ Sauce, and to see that their names are upon the wrapper, labels, stopper, and bottle. Some of the foreign markets having been supplied with a spurious Worcestershire Sauce, upon the wrapper and labels of which the names of Lea and Perrins have been forged, L. and P. give notice that they have furnished their correspondents with powers of attorney to take instant proceedings against manufacturers and vendors of such, or any other imitations by which their right may be infringed. Ask for Lea and Perkins’ Sauce, and see name on wrapper, label, bottle, and stopper. Wholesale and for export by the proprietors, Worcester; Crosse and Blackwell, London, &c, &c; and by Grocers and Oilmen universally. IT' LEY’S AMMUNITION. BOXEK L CARTRIDGES for SNIDER RIFLE. The above Cartridges are made in three sizes viz., -577 (or Snider Enfield) bore; 500 (or half-inch) bore ; and '451 (or small) bore. These cartridges have been adopted after careful comparative trials against all other descriptions, by Her Majesty’s War Department, as the Standard Rifle Ammunition, for the British Army, and are not only used exclusively for the Snider Rifle, but are adapted to all other systems of military Breech-loading Rifles. They are the cheapest Cartridges known, carrying their own ignition, and being made wholly Metal, are Waterproof, and imperishable in any climate. Boxer Cartridge Cases (empty), of all three sizes, packed with or without bullets, and machine for fastening same in Cartridges. Makers of Boxer Cartridges, '450 bore, for Revolving Pistols, in use in her Majesty’s Navy. Pin Cartridges, for Lefaucheux Revolvers of 12 m, 9 m, and 7 m bore. Central Fire and Pin Fire Cartridges for all sizes of Guns, Rifles, and Revolvers. Double Waterproof and E B Caps. Wire Cartridges for killing game at long distances. Felt waddings to improve the shooting of guns; and every description of Sporting and Military Ammunition. ELEY, BROTHERS, Gray’ Inn Road, London W.C., Wholesale only.
